Senior Test and Evaluation Engineer

BTAS, Inc. is a woman-owned small business specializing in IT, Engineering, and Program Management, and they are seeking a Senior Test and Evaluation Engineer to support the Space Systems Command. The role involves providing technical advice throughout the acquisition life cycle, developing acquisition documentation, and supporting risk management efforts for various programs related to space operations.

Responsibilities

Support Space Acquisitions and Engineering: Provide technical advice for projects at any stage of the acquisition life cycle, including advanced technology, concept development, and integration
Advise on Cost, Schedule, and Performance: Assist the government in managing acquisition programs efficiently
Develop and Revise Acquisition Documentation: Draft and update Joint Capabilities Integrated Development System (JCIDS) and acquisition documents, including Capability Documents, Acquisition Strategies, Concept of Operations, Technical Evaluations, and reports, following government standards (e.g., MIL-STD)
Provide Technical and Programmatic Reports: Prepare SME-level status reports on individual programs or the entire portfolio in coordination with government program managers
Identify and Mitigate Risks: Recommend and implement acquisition process improvements, risk mitigation plans, and programmatic changes. Support risk management efforts, including risk identification and mitigation strategies
Monitor and Maintain Program Schedules: Track acquisition implementation, report requirement gaps, assess program risks, and update acquisition reports based on program execution data
Support Technical Engagements: Advise and assist with technical meetings, design reviews, working groups, program conferences, and contractor and customer coordination
Mission Protection and Operations: Provide insights and solutions for mission protection, operations, and data assessments. Conduct impact analyses, compliance audits, readiness reviews, and technical anomaly evaluations
Command and Control (C2) Integration: Support ongoing and advanced C2 efforts, ensuring integration with classified portfolios. Act as a liaison between Space C2, Enterprise Ground Services (EGS), and classified program offices

Required

Active TS with SCI eligibility
Highly knowledgeable in classified space control systems engineering processes and procedures, including but not limited to requirements development, technology maturation, test, and evaluation
Knowledgeable in model based systems engineering's application to requirements refinement, architecture, design, verification, and validation
Demonstrates ability to organize and conduct technical design reviews and audits
Experience working in a technical role within SZ/BC within the last 10 years
